Clinical Trial: A Phase 1, Dose-Escalation, Positron Emission Tomography Study to Assess the Safety, Pharmacokinetics, Dosimetry and Biodistribution of GEH200521 (18F) Injection Co-Administered With GEH200520 Injection in Healthy Volunteers

Study Status: COMPLETED

Recruit Status: COMPLETED

Condition: Healthy Volunteers

Study Type: INTERVENTIONAL


Official Title: A Phase 1, Single-Center, Open-Label, Single-Arm, Dose-Escalation, Positron Emission Tomography Study to Assess the Safety and Tolerability, Immunogenicity, Pharmacokinetics, Dosimetry and Biodistribu

Brief Summary: This is a Phase 1, single-center, open-label, single-arm, dose-escalation positron emission tomography study to assess the safety and tolerability, immunogenicity, Pharmacokinetics, dosimetry, and biodistribution after GEH200521 (18F) Injection is co-administered with GEH200520 Injection in healthy volunteers.The estimated study duration for each subject is approximately 28 days in part A and 34 days in part B.The primary study objective is to evaluate the safety and tolerability of the IMPs, the selected mass…
